Indow Windows completed a $2.6 million funding round as it prepares to expand nationally.
The company plans to use the influx to back new product development, sales, marketing and operations as part of a national expansion. Indow already has dealers in 26 states and Vancouver, B.C.
Indow makes window inserts that consist of a sheet of acrylic glazing edged with a patented compression tube that presses into the inside of a window frame. The inserts, made in the U.S., require no destructive hardware, and provide increased comfort, lower energy bills and quieter spaces.
